Geniculate Artery Embolization for Osteoarthritis
The need for exploration of more definitive and cost effective non-arthroplasty treatments of osteoarthritis (OA) has been demonstrated by the orthopedic and health economic research. Embolotherapy of neovessels associated with OA joints has been shown to be promising in patients with knee OA. There is a need for level one evidence drawn from randomized clinical trials to prove the safety, feasibility and efficacy of knee embolotherapy compared to standard of care. This randomized pilot study will assign 10 patients with mild-moderate OA to undergo geniculate artery embolization plus standard of care (defined in this study as: physical therapy and oral anti-inflammatory medications, with a maximum of 1 joint injection at the time of enrollment) and 10 patients to receive only medical standard of care (also having had a maximum of 1 joint injection prior to enrollment). The goal of this pilot study is to obtain preliminary estimates of safety and efficacy of embolotherapy to provide sustained symptom control and modify disease progression in patients with mild to moderate knee OA.

The Role of Rumination and Worry in Pain and Functional Limitation in Knee Osteoarthritis
Knee osteoarthritis is a common degenerative joint disease in which pain severity often does not fully correspond with radiographic disease severity. Psychological processes such as rumination and worry may contribute to differences in pain perception and functional limitation among patients with similar structural disease burden. The purpose of this observational study is to investigate the relationships between radiographic osteoarthritis severity, pain severity, functional limitation, rumination, and worry in patients with knee osteoarthritis. Radiographic severity will be assessed using the Kellgren-Lawrence classification. Participants will complete the Penn State Worry Questionnaire, the Ruminative Thought Style Questionnaire, the Visual Analog Scale (VAS), and the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C). The study aims to determine whether rumination and worry are associated with pain severity and functional impairment independently of radiographic osteoarthritis severity. Findings from this study may improve understanding of the biopsychosocial mechanisms underlying pain perception in knee osteoarthritis and may support the development of multidisciplinary treatment approaches that incorporate psychological factors into patient assessment and management.

Use of a Putty as Gap Filler in Open-wedge Osteotomy
Rationale: Realignment osteotomies around the knee are a proven surgical treatment for unicompartmental knee osteoarthritis and a malalignment. Osteotomies can be very painful in the early postoperative phase. This is probably due to a combination of bony cut (bone pain) and postoperative hematoma (bleeding and leakage of the bone marrow) in the surrounding soft tissue. The AttraX® Putty can be used as a gap filler in open wedge osteotomies to potentially reduce postoperative pain by reducing the bleeding from the bone gap. Objective: The main aim of this study is to determine whether early postoperative pain is decreased when the osteotomy gap is filled with AttraX® Putty, compared to conventional open wedge osteotomy without filling the gap. The secondary aims are faster accelerated rehabilitation/regaining function, reduction of local blood loss, accelerated bone union, comparable surgical accuracy, and the occurrence of (serious) adverse events. Study design: Single-blinded, prospective, randomized controlled trial. Study population: Adult patients qualifying for open-wedge tibial, open-wedge femur or double level osteotomy. Intervention: According to a randomization scheme, the osteotomy gap will be filled with either the synthetic ceramic material AttraX® Putty or without a gap filler (conventional method). Main study parameters/endpoints: The main study endpoint is the Numeric Rating Scale (NRS) pain during the first week postoperative. The secondary study endpoints are faster rehabilitation/regaining function, reduction of local blood loss, accelerated bone union, comparable surgical accuracy, and (serious) adverse events. Nature and extent of the burden and risks associated with participation, benefit and group relatedness: Patients may have the advantage of experiencing less pain postoperatively if they are treated with the AttraX® Putty, which can contribute to a faster rehabilitation. Risks to the AttraX® Putty group may include an allergic reaction, failure to promote bone fusion and excessive bone growth. However, the preclinical studies and clinical studies show that the use of AttraX® Putty is safe for use in humans.

The Impact of Single-shot Adductor Canal Block Versus Continuous Femoral Nerve Block on Rehabilitation After Total Knee Replacement
Total knee replacement (TKR) is considered the most effective and safe method of radical treatment of late stages of knee osteoarthritis. A well-known problem of TKR is a severe postoperative pain syndrome, which is observed in more than 50% of patients. Femoral nerve block (FNB) is the "gold standard" for continuous postoperative analgesia after total knee replacement, as it is effective in reducing the frequency of use of opioid analgetics and reduce the duration of hospitalization. At the same time, the negative effect of this method is the motor blockade of the quadriceps femoris muscle which leads to functional impairment and is associated with an increased risk of falling. Adductor canal block (ACB) provides adequate analgesia comparable to femoral nerve block. Moreover, ACB doesn't affect the motor function of the quadriceps femoris muscle. The possibility of enhanced recovery after total knee replacement is the reason to compare single-shot adductor canal block and continuous femoral nerve block.

Metformin Safety and Efficacy in Osteoarthritis.
Knee osteoarthritis (OA) is a chronic, painful disease associated with considerable morbidity, costs and disability. It is estimated that over a third of people aged over 60 have radiographic knee OA2 and over 50% of these with knee OA will go on to have a total knee replacement in their lifetime. At present there are no licensed treatments that alter disease progress and management is primarily concerned with symptom control to retain or improve joint function, although a trial of strontium ranelate showed promising results.

The Role of Vitamin K on Knee Osteoarthritis Outcomes
The appropriate form and dosing of vitamin K to benefit relevant outcomes in knee osteoarthritis (OA) are not known. In intervention studies for conditions other than knee OA (e.g., prevention of cardiovascular disease), the most commonly used forms and doses include phylloquinone (vitamin K1; 1000µg or 500µg daily) or menaquinone-7 (MK-7 or vitamin K2; 300µg daily). However, whether these doses are adequate to increase vitamin K to levels that ameliorate risk of adverse OA outcomes is not known. Furthermore, although some studies suggest enhanced bioavailability of MK-7 over vitamin K1, as well as extra-hepatic effects, whether this is relevant for an older population with knee OA is not known, The overall goal of this pilot randomized clinical trial (RCT) is to test different subtypes and doses of vitamin K supplementation in older adults with knee OA and to measure changes in relevant biochemical measures.

Effects of Vitamin K on Lower-extremity Function in Adults With Osteoarthritis:
The overall goal of this pilot randomized trial is to obtain necessary prerequisite data to conduct a randomized controlled intervention to test the effect of vitamin K supplementation on knee osteoarthritis progression and related functional decline. To address critical parameters required to design this larger RCT, we will conduct a double-blind, 2-armed, parallel-group intervention study, with a placebo run-in, in which 50 adults with mild to moderate knee OA and low baseline vitamin K status will be randomly assigned to 1 mg phylloquinone/day or matching placebo, and treated for 6 months. Specifically, we will: (1) compare the effects of 1 mg/day phylloquinone vs. placebo on the non-functional circulating form of MGP; (2) estimate rates of recruitment and retention, follow-up rates and reasons for loss to follow-up, response rates to questionnaires, adherence/compliance rates, and potential for site differences; and (3) determine the responsiveness of the Osteoarthritis Research Society International (OARSI)-recommended performance-based tests of physical function in adults with low vitamin K status and mild to moderate knee osteoarthritis. We will also obtain preliminary data on the distribution of MGP genotype at two clinical sites for effect size generation.
